The Ministry of Health (MoH) (Amharic: ጤና ሚኒስቴር) is the Ethiopian government department responsible for public health concerns.
Its head office is on Sudan Street in Addis Ababa.
[2] Mekdes Daba has been the head of the ministry since February 2024.
The Ministry of Public Health was created in 1948 followed by Proclamation issued in 1946.
[2] In recent years, the ministry promotes family planning programs introduced contraceptives, giving women a choice over their sexual and reproductive health while combatting child marriage and harmful practice in Ethiopia.
